A resourceful modder has taken apart a Steam Deck and created a screenless console dubbed the 'Steam Brick'. Motivated by the Steam Deck's size, the modder wanted a smaller device for backpack portability. By removing the screen, controls, and associated components, they successfully created a compact console powered by the Steam Deck's internals. While functional, the modder cautions against replicating this process, calling it a 'very bad idea'. Rumours suggest Valve might be developing a dedicated TV-based SteamOS device, potentially offering a safer alternative to DIY modifications.

The Steam Deck is a very popular handheld gaming device that lets you play many of your favorite PC games on the go. But what if it was a screenless console you had to plug into a TV to use? Well, someone ripped their own Steam Deck apart to make just that and called it a “Steam Brick.

After some tinkering, the modder realized that they could remove all the inner boards and components related to the touch pads, analog sticks, buttons, and other controls and the Steam Deck would still work. They also removed the screen and any components and bits connected to it and it still worked. Next they printed out a small, basic plastic case and shoved what was left of the Steam Deck’s carcass into the box, sealed it up and added a USB port and power button and...
